JACKSONVILLE, Fla. -- Jacksonville Jaguars head coach Liam Coen said it's too early to start wondering about Travis Hunter 's future as a two-way player.
The rookie receiver/cornerback had surgery Tuesday to repair the lateral collateral ligament in his right knee; discussion over his future position or positions will happen in the offseason.
"I understand there's a lot of questions about if he'll remain a two-way player and all those kind of things," Coen said Wednesday morning. "All of that is very premature and at the end of the day, like every player on this roster, he'll be evaluated at the end of the season and we'll be able to give him his three better, three best and the things that we need to continue to improve upon and the things we need to build on.
